.container.svelte-1uha8ag{min-height:calc(100vh - 57px);padding:var(--space-2xl)}.hero.svelte-1uha8ag{display:flex;flex-direction:column;align-items:center;justify-content:center;min-height:calc(100vh - 153px);text-align:center}.logo.svelte-1uha8ag{display:inline-flex;align-items:center;justify-content:center;width:64px;height:64px;background:var(--cyan-dim);border:1px solid var(--cyan);border-radius:12px;color:var(--cyan);margin-bottom:var(--space-lg);box-shadow:0 0 20px var(--cyan-glow)}.hero.svelte-1uha8ag h1:where(.svelte-1uha8ag){font-family:var(--font-mono);font-size:2.5rem;font-weight:700;letter-spacing:-.02em;margin-bottom:var(--space-sm)}.hero.svelte-1uha8ag p:where(.svelte-1uha8ag){color:var(--text-secondary);font-size:1.125rem;margin-bottom:var(--space-xl)}.cta.svelte-1uha8ag{font-family:var(--font-mono);font-size:14px;color:var(--bg-primary);background:var(--cyan);padding:var(--space-md) var(--space-xl);border-radius:8px;text-decoration:none;font-weight:600;transition:all .15s ease}.cta.svelte-1uha8ag:hover{background:#3df;box-shadow:0 0 20px var(--cyan-glow)}.dashboard.svelte-1uha8ag h1:where(.svelte-1uha8ag){font-family:var(--font-mono);font-size:1.5rem;font-weight:600;margin-bottom:var(--space-xl)}.modules.svelte-1uha8ag{display:grid;grid-template-columns:repeat(auto-fit,minmax(280px,1fr));gap:var(--space-lg)}.module-card.svelte-1uha8ag{display:flex;gap:var(--space-md);padding:var(--space-lg);background:var(--bg-card);border:1px solid var(--border-subtle);border-radius:8px;text-decoration:none;transition:all .15s ease}.module-card.svelte-1uha8ag:hover{border-color:var(--cyan);box-shadow:0 0 20px #00d4ff1a}.module-card__icon.svelte-1uha8ag{display:flex;align-items:center;justify-content:center;width:48px;height:48px;background:var(--cyan-dim);border-radius:8px;color:var(--cyan);flex-shrink:0}.module-card__content.svelte-1uha8ag h2:where(.svelte-1uha8ag){font-family:var(--font-mono);font-size:14px;font-weight:600;color:var(--text-primary);margin-bottom:var(--space-xs)}.module-card__content.svelte-1uha8ag p:where(.svelte-1uha8ag){font-size:13px;color:var(--text-secondary)}
